302 .040 bore.. fresh rebuilt engine by professional racer. 10.5:1 compression set up with NOS cheater kit. Old TrickFlow Highports Victor Jr 750 AED its quick runs great.. has won carolina renegade with a 10.60 @ 130 mph pass Blue interior 140 speedo 5 speed car.. has airbag in right rear 90/10's in front alum driveshaft 33 spline axles with full spool 3.73 gears No Power steering though heat works..
